About

Wei Hao Lai is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Polymers and Plastics. According to data from OpenAlex, Wei Hao Lai has authored 25 papers receiving a total of 881 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Materials Chemistry, 11 papers in Electrical and Electronic Engineering and 7 papers in Polymers and Plastics. Recurrent topics in Wei Hao Lai's work include Gas Sensing Nanomaterials and Sensors (7 papers), Transition Metal Oxide Nanomaterials (6 papers) and Gold and Silver Nanoparticles Synthesis and Applications (5 papers). Wei Hao Lai is often cited by papers focused on Gas Sensing Nanomaterials and Sensors (7 papers), Transition Metal Oxide Nanomaterials (6 papers) and Gold and Silver Nanoparticles Synthesis and Applications (5 papers). Wei Hao Lai collaborates with scholars based in Taiwan, China and United States. Wei Hao Lai's co-authors include Lay Gaik Teoh, Min Hsiung Hon, Yen‐Hsun Su, Jiann Shieh, Min‐Hsiung Hon, I‐Ming Hung, Wei Zheng, Sheng Feng, Wei Wu and Yun Zhou and has published in prestigious journals such as Applied Physics Letters, Advanced Energy Materials and Chemical Engineering Journal.
